NATCOM bill proponent cautions against divisive utterances

Date:

The proponent of the proposed National Commission for the Coordination and Control of the Proliferation of Small Arms, Ammunitions, Light Weapons, and Pipeline Vandalism in Nigeria (NATCOM), Dr. Baba Mohammed, FCNA, has reacted to various comments, reactions, messages, and posts on some social media platforms in response to the publication issued by the Office of the National Security Adviser (ONSA) to the President regarding the alleged illegal activities of certain individuals claiming affiliation with NATCOM.

In a statement issued in Abuja, the Coordinating Director of Human Resources of the proposed commission, Mr. David Olaitan, restated that Dr. Baba Mohammed is a staunch supporter of proper procedures, an adept administrator, and a law-abiding citizen.

As such, the statement categorically distances him from such remarks, reactions, and publications.

It cautions all self-proclaimed members of NATCOM and the general public against misrepresenting his character or the proposed NATCOM.

The statement further warns that anyone found engaging in such behavior will be subject to legal consequences and that Dr. Baba Mohammed holds the Office of the NSA in high regard and is committed to upholding its directives without exception.
